In 30 seconds
This systematic review and meta-analysis evaluated the effectiveness of convalescent plasma (CCP) in immunocompromised COVID-19 patients who remained positive for SARS-CoV-2 after anti-Spike monoclonal antibody (mAb) therapy. Among 47 patients, 70.2% achieved viral clearance following CCP transfusion, with an average of 2.7 units administered. The study highlights the potential role of CCP in managing resistant infections in this vulnerable population.
Key findings
- 70.2% of patients achieved SARS-CoV-2 clearance after CCP transfusion.
- A mean of 2.7 CCP units was administered per patient.
- Total CCP volume transfused was positively associated with viral clearance.
